JUSTICE RAKESH KUMAR ORAL ORDER 20-10-2016 Heard Sri Mukesh Kumar Rana, learned counsel for the petitioners and Sri Umesh Lal Verma, learned Addl. Public Prosecutor.
Three petitioners, who are in custody since 25.07.2016 in Jokihat (Mahalgaon ) P.S. Case No.221 of 2016 registered for the offence under Sections 341, 323, 324, 326, 307, 379, 354B, 504, 506/34 of the Indian Penal Code and subsequently Section 302 of the Indian Penal Code was added, have prayed for grant of bail.
It was submitted by learned counsel for the petitioner that prior to lodging of the present case, from the petitioners' side also, an F.I.R. vide Jokihat( Mahalgaon) P.S.
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.43128 of 2016 (2) dt.20-10-2016 2/2 Case No.219of 2016 was lodged under Section 307 and other allied Sections of the Indian Penal Code. He submits that there is general and omnibus allegation against the petitioners and, as such, petitioners deserve to be released on bail. Sri Umesh Lal Verma, learned Addl. Public Prosecutor, opposing the prayer for bail of the petitioners, submits that there is specific accusation against petitioner nos.1 and 2. So far as petitioner no.3 is concerned, he accepts that there is general and omnibus allegation against him.
Keeping in view the fact that there is specific accusation against petitioner nos. 1 and 2, namely, (i) Eklakh and (ii) Hassan Reza, their prayer for bail is rejected. So far as petitioner no.3, namely, Arif @ Md. Arif is concerned, keeping in view the fact that there is general and omnibus allegation against him, he is directed to be released on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s.10,000/-( 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ned Sub Divisional Judicial Magistrate, Araria in connection with Jokihat (Mahalgaon) P.S.
